Sun City West is a medium-sized town located in the state of Arizona. With a population of 26,264 people and two constituent neighborhoods, Sun City West is the 23rd largest community in Arizona.
Sun City West is a decidedly white-collar town, with fully 88.16% of the workforce employed in white-collar jobs, well above the national average. Overall, Sun City West is a town of sales and office workers, service providers, and professionals. There are especially a lot of people living in Sun City West who work in sales jobs (25.57%), office and administrative support jobs (18.08%), and personal care services (7.18%).
Of important note, Sun City West is also a town of artists. Sun City West has more artists, designers and people working in media than 90% of the communities in America. This concentration of artists helps shape Sun City West's character.
Telecommuters are a relatively large percentage of the workforce: 7.34% of people work from home. While this number may seem small overall, as a fraction of the total workforce it is high relative to the nation. These workers are often telecommuters who work in knowledge-based, white-collar professions. For example, Silicon Valley has large numbers of people who telecommute. Other at-home workers may be self-employed people who operate small businesses out of their homes.
Seniors make up 82.60% of Sun City West's population, making it a popular place to retire. Because of the prominence of the retirement community, Sun City West is good place for those over 65 to settle, as they will find many opportunities for socializing, as well as having access to many services oriented toward seniors.
Being a small town, Sun City West does not have a public transit system used by locals to get to and from work.
In terms of college education, Sun City West is substantially better educated than the typical community in the nation, which has 14.96% of the adults holding a bachelor's degree or graduate degree: 29.94% of adults in Sun City West have a college degree.
The per capita income in Sun City West in 2000 was $32,049, which is wealthy relative to Arizona and the nation. This equates to an annual income of $128,196 for a family of four.
The people who call Sun City West home come from a variety of different races and ancestries. The most prevalent race in Sun City West is White, followed by African-American. Important ancestries of people in Sun City West include German, English, Irish, Italian, Polish, Swedish, Norwegian, Scottish, Scotch-Irish, and French.
The most common language spoken in Sun City West is English.
